HELP ME DECIDE! :) UCLA vs USC (Biology/Pre-med) by connorqiu in collegecompare

  1. I would say they are ranked similarly. Neither school has an especially outstanding biology program.
  2. Yes, ucla is bigger but usc is also huge. Competition will be tough either way. With usc being a private school, you can have a closer relationship with counselors and receive a bit more attention. I have multiple family members at UCLA who have said that their counseling is not great. Also as a scholarship recipient you will have even more attention (apparently).
  3. I wouldn’t say that’s necessarily true it really depends on the basis of what your professor is like.
  4. True
  5. UCLA is a great school and wouldn’t appear as just “some old state school”
  6. I believe there may be more research opportunities (especially as a scholarship recipient)
  7. Both have great social scenes. Usc is plenty diverse; I would say the types of people at each school are quite similar.
  8. It is true that UCLA is in a nicer area. More pleasant surroundings for sure. On the other hand USC also has a bit more of a “cushy” campus (some newer facilities, more space per student)

Both are excellent schools and there is no wrong choice. If you feel like you may need more attention and guidance, USC would probably be a bit better. Hope this helps.
